Output 2235836a3fbb819b6bc8261e60d8f0d6a2964b88c2049a1e04108e3733190973:12

value
66425082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ba842023691e976e6687488584e612da8c18e936 OP_EQUAL
address
MQuNCMVYKUfJGkfTnCCHboRZqR78CdZV7F
transaction
2235836a3fbb819b6bc8261e60d8f0d6a2964b88c2049a1e04108e3733190973
spent
true